Panchayat elections: Corona infected will also be able to vote, the commission said that this work will have to be done


Posted on 13th Apr 2021 03:20 pm by rohit kumar

There is great information for voters of the Panchayat elections that are occurring amid the Corona epidemic. Now infected voters can also vote in elections. Election observer Dr. Arvind Kumar Chaurasia said that Corona-infected voters will be able to vote in panchayat elections.

 

 

He told that the family of the Corona-infected would have to inform the returning officer in writing the day before the vote. According to the commission's instructions, before the polling, an infected voter can be put to vote by wearing a PPE kit. During this time the sector magistrate will also be wearing a PPE kit. After that, the room will be sanitized.

Let me tell you that the corona infection has reached a very frightening state in UP. In the last 24 hours, there have been 18,021 new cases in the state, which is a record so far. 13685 were found infected on Monday. In the new cases of Corona, 5382 alone belongs to Lucknow. Apart from this, 1856 new cases have been reported in Prayagraj, 1404 in Varanasi, and 1271 in Kanpur.

 

Record 72 people died

Earlier on Monday, there was some decrease in the number of new patients, but a record 72 people died due to infection. This is the maximum depth in a day in the second wave of Corona. 13,685 infected were found in the state on Monday. A day earlier on Sunday, 15,353 patients were found.

 

3892 infected found in Lucknow

At the same time, 3892 infected were found in Lucknow. 4444 were found infected on Sunday. Apart from this, 1417 patients were found in Varanasi, 1295 in Prayagraj, 716 in Kanpur Nagar, 474 in Gorakhpur, 336 in Meerut, 267 in Jhansi, 239 in Gautam Budh Nagar, 230 in Ballia. On Sunday, 1.93 lakh samples were tested, while on Saturday 2,03,780 samples were tested.
